Title: Takuya Nomura: Innovator in Power Conversion and Vehicle Systems
Introduction
Takuya Nomura is a distinguished inventor based in Saitama, Japan, recognized for his contributions to the fields of power conversion and vehicle technology. With a total of two patents to his name, he has made significant advancements that enhance the safety and efficiency of modern vehicles.
Latest Patents
Nomura's latest patents include a "Failure Detection Device of Power Converter" and a "Parking Lock System." The failure detection device addresses the challenges faced by power converters in low refrigerant flow conditions. It features a first inverter circuit composed of six transistors and includes diodes with temperature sensors for each transistor to monitor temperatures accurately. A failure determination member plays a crucial role in this device, as it selects adjacent sensor pairs to assess the health of the temperature sensing system.
The parking lock system represents another innovative approach, utilizing a link member that swings due to the sliding of an operating shaft. This design incorporates a counterweight that counteracts axial inertial force, preventing unintended parking lock operations during scenarios such as frontal collisions or sudden braking. This inventive feature enhances vehicle safety by ensuring that the parking lock only engages under appropriate conditions.
